One of the most appealing things about Vera Wang wedding dresses is the very wide range of materials and fabrics that are available. Whatever material you choose, you can rest assured that it will be the finest there is, from Chantilly lace to hand-painted organza. The detail is also beautiful: some are adorned with gorgeous embroidery, organza ribbons or horsehair sashes, all perfectly placed to make the most of your figure and enhance your natural waist.

Vera Wang wedding dresses also offer a much wider range of colours than most other collections, which mostly consist of white and ivory coloured dresses. That’s not to say you have to go somewhere else if you would prefer a more traditional colour like white or ivory: look up Vera Wang wedding dresses 2010 as most the dresses in this collection are in more traditional colours, and there’s plenty of choice. There are also white and ivory dresses in the 2011 collections.

If you are open to beiges, grey, pinks and other colours, then you should head straight for the spring and fall 2011 collections of Vera Wang wedding dresses. You may struggle to picture yourself in a caramel or medium-grey coloured dress right now, but when you see them I bet you’ll change your mind. These colours can actually be much more flattering than white, depending on your skin tone. White is also often less forgiving of lumps and bumps that you might want to keep hidden on your wedding day!

There are also many different shapes and styles to suit different heights and body shapes, from traditional bodices with long flowing skirts to asymmetric styles, mermaid gowns and dresses with peplum bodices or skirts.
